For me Fuzzrocious is best known for its Feed Me and lunaRecplise multi-clipping pedals, 420, Cicada, Croak and Grey Stache Fuzzes, Knob / Octave Jawn Octaver, Electro-Faustus Greyfly collaboration, Cat Tail and Cat King Rat-style Distortions, and The Demon / Demon King Overdrive / Distortion which the Li’l Fella is evolved from.

 

So the Li’l Fella compacts and expands on the prowess of The Demon, and significantly extends its range into more Fuzz flavours too. You have smart dual Gain Stage controls in the form of the Drive and Gain knobs - which give you every shade of Overdrive and Distortion when combined. You then move things into more crunched, chuggy, and fuzz-like flavours by engaging the Gate - and then fine-tune to taste with the Volume and Tone controls. Actually a really simple control topology, but calibrated for maximum impact with a wider range of Tones and Gain than in the core The Demon.

 

The aesthetics of the pedal are just perfect and feature a cool Peacock Spider graphic by Shannon - undeniably the world’s cutest spiders - hailing from Australia, and typically only about 5mm in size! As is common for Fuzzrocious, these come in a variety of different colourways via different dealers. The stock default model is pictured far left - the ’white’ variety, while my favourite and the one I acquired from good friend Scott at Axe and You Shall Receive is the Canadian Dealers’s Purple Metalflake special edition.
